With over 28,000 stores operating across 76 countries, Starbucks is rightly considered a leading global brand. However, there is one country where Starbucks' international expansion came badly unstuck - Australia.

This superb video from CNBC explores why Starbucks failed to establish a leadership position in the $6bn Australian coffee shop market.

It also explains why a competitor brand - Gloria Jeans - has succeeded where Starbucks failed.
